Hi there,I find that sites online vary in sizes even if it's the same bag. Since some companies include the length of the flap as the height when it's opened. And others don't so it seems shorter since it's closed. But it's really the same bag ha. If you are confused about which bag is the mini and which one is not when ordering from whichever site you choose, compare it to the sizes on the Marc Jacobs site.
I actually received my Classic Q Natasha in the mail today. I got it in black and it's the regular sized one. It's the perfect medium sized bag! I am 5'3" and it hits perfectly at the hip when used as a crossbody, when adjusted to the last hole. As a shoulder bag, it's a bit longer and hits right below my behind ha. Hope this helps!
